The purpose of the Basic 45, as taught by
Grandmaster Jimmy H. Woo, is to teach proper timing,
coordination and balance utilizing power and leverage. When
practiced correctly, these lessons will help you develop the proper
mechanics for hand-to-hand fighting.
The lessons and ideas in the Basic 45 are designed for all levels
of experience. As you put the concepts presented in the Basic 45 to use, you will achieve a
greater understanding and a more effective method for self-defense.
Beside the physical benefits of Kung Fu San Soo, the Basic 45 will also help
instill confidence, self-control, awareness and a feeling of
accomplishment.
Each of the tapes in the series and the DVDs Set include
multiple Break-Out Sessions
in which Master Jack Sera discusses key points on proper mechanics
that will be sure to increase your skill set no matter what your
level of expertise.

In this first DVD, Lessons 1-30 of the Basic 45,
Master Jack Sera covers the first 30 lessons of the Basic 45. In
addition, he also covers the 5 basic hand leverages that Grandmaster
Woo taught along with the Basic 45.
The six Break-Out Sessions on this DVD cover:
- Various blocking methods including proper
mechanics and direction.
- How positioning and driving with your legs
will help you generate more power.
- Additional key ideas about various blocks
including; areas to block with, shoulder rotation and establishing
proper angle.
- Improving target range and accessibility,
horse stances, their transitions and how to utilize them.
- Fundamental concepts for using hand
leverages.
- Proper methods for various kicks including direction and striking portions of the feet.

In this second DVD, Lessons 31-45 of the
Basic 45 and Basic Baton Exercises, Master Jack Sera covers the last 15
lessons of the Basic 45. He will continue to expand upon the
concepts and ideas previously covered in the first DVD.
The four Break-Out Sessions on this DVD cover:
- Blocking and catching as well as why Kung
Fu San Soo has no stylistic starting position.
- Insight into kicking low & high as
well as the relation of hand-to-foot speed and how to coordinate
them.
- The opponent's reactions, knowing how to
use them and how the techniques conform to them.
- Why mirroring techniques is both inefficient and undesirable.
In addition, Master Jack Sera covers the baton which is not a traditional Chinese weapon,
yet it is very versatile and can be adapted readily into Kung Fu fighting concepts.
These techniques were perfected by Grandmaster Jimmy H. Woo, and can easily be
applied when you learn and understand how to use them as an extension of your hand.
